1963 In northeast Italy, over 2,000 people are killed when a large landslide behind the Vajont Dam causes a giant wave of water to overtop it.
1970 The Ancash earthquake causes a landslide that buries the town of Yungay, Peru; more than 47,000 people are killed.
1971 In Peru a landslide crashes into Lake Yanahuani, killing 200 at the mining camp of Chungar.
2000 A catastrophic landslide in Log pod Mangartom, Slovenia, kills 7, and causes millions of SIT of damage. It is one of the worst catastrophes in Slovenia in the past 100 years.
2010 A train derailed near Merano, Italy, after running into a landslide, causing nine deaths and injuring 28 people.
